How much does it cost to replace a power window regulator?
In many cars, window regulators last the car’s lifetime. However, unexpected failures can occur, typically after 100,000km, that require window regulator replacement. On average, a new window regulator will cost between $300 and $450 and sometimes more, depending on the make and model of the car you drive.
Replacing a power window regulator can be a necessary and sometimes costly repair for vehicle owners. The cost to replace a power window regulator can vary depending on several factors such as the make and model of the vehicle, the specific part needed, and labor costs.
On average, the cost to replace a power window regulator ranges from $150 to $500 per window. This estimate includes the cost of the replacement part, which can vary widely depending on whether you choose to purchase a new regulator from the manufacturer or opt for a more affordable aftermarket part. Labor costs also play a significant role in the overall expense, as the process of replacing a power window regulator can be labor-intensive and may require specialized tools.
Some vehicle owners may choose to tackle the replacement themselves to save on labor costs, but it’s essential to have the necessary knowledge and expertise to complete the job safely and effectively. For those who prefer to leave it to the professionals, labor costs can add several hundred dollars to the total expense.

How do I know if my car window regulator is bad?
Symptoms of a bad window regulator include the regulator making creaking noises, the glass panel refusing to go up or down, and the window not staying up. Other symptoms include the glass panel being crooked, sluggish or quick power window operation, and the glass panel separating from the window regulator.
If you suspect your car window regulator might be malfunctioning, there are several signs to look out for. The window regulator is a crucial component responsible for the smooth operation of your car’s windows. Here are some indicators that it may be failing:
Unusual Noises: A common sign of a faulty window regulator is strange noises when you try to operate the window, such as grinding, clicking, or crunching sounds. These noises often indicate worn-out or damaged components within the regulator mechanism.
Slow or Sluggish Movement: If your car window moves slowly or struggles to go up or down, it could be a sign of a failing regulator. This may be caused by worn-out motor gears, damaged cables, or insufficient lubrication within the regulator assembly.
Window Stuck in One Position: Another clear indication of a bad window regulator is when the window gets stuck and refuses to move at all. This could be due to a complete failure of the regulator mechanism, such as a broken cable or motor.
What causes car window regulator to fail?
The window regulator can overheat from excessive use and stress over time, which can lead to a complete failure of the regulator. If a motor starts to overheat, the best practice would be to let it cool down before trying to use it again. Freezing temperatures can cause a window to disconnect from a window regulator.
Car window regulators play a crucial role in the smooth operation of car windows, but they can sometimes fail unexpectedly, causing inconvenience and frustration for vehicle owners. Several factors contribute to the failure of car window regulators.
One common cause of window regulator failure is wear and tear over time. Constant use of the windows can lead to the wearing down of the regulator’s components, such as cables, pulleys, and gears. This wear can eventually cause these parts to malfunction or break altogether.
Another factor is the accumulation of dirt, debris, and moisture within the window regulator assembly. These contaminants can interfere with the movement of the regulator components, causing them to become stuck or operate less efficiently. Additionally, exposure to harsh weather conditions like extreme temperatures, rain, or snow can accelerate this deterioration process.

What are the two types of window regulators?
There are two types of window regulators: manual and power. Manual window regulators are operated by a hand crank, while power regulators are activated by an electric motor – the type most commonly found in modern vehicles.
Window regulators are essential components in vehicles, responsible for controlling the up and down movement of the windows. There are two primary types of window regulators commonly found in automobiles: manual and power window regulators.
Manual Window Regulators:
Manual window regulators are operated by hand, usually through a hand crank located on the interior door panel. When the crank is turned, it engages a mechanical system of gears and cables, which in turn moves the window up or down along its track. While manual regulators are simple in design and reliable, they require physical effort from the occupant to operate the windows, which can be inconvenient, especially for drivers.
Power Window Regulators:
Power window regulators, on the other hand, are motorized systems that automate the process of raising and lowering the windows with the push of a button. A small electric motor is connected to a series of gears and cables, which actuate the window mechanism. Power window regulators offer convenience and ease of use, allowing occupants to control multiple windows simultaneously from the driver’s seat. However, they are more complex than manual regulators and can be prone to electrical or mechanical failures.
What if power window is not working?
Visually inspect cables or window guides for broken or misaligned pieces. If you see a loose or broken cable and hear the motor moving when you hit the window switch, the window regulator may need to be replaced. If the cables are intact and the guides are aligned, the window motor may have stripped gears.
When your power window fails to function, it can be frustrating and inconvenient, but there are several potential causes and solutions to explore. Firstly, check the fuse box for any blown fuses related to the power windows. If a fuse is blown, replace it and see if the window operates again. If not, there may be an issue with the wiring or the window motor.
Next, examine the window switch. Over time, the switch can wear out or become dirty, leading to malfunction. Cleaning or replacing the switch may resolve the problem.
If the switch and fuses are in good condition, the issue may lie with the window motor. A malfunctioning motor will need to be replaced by a professional mechanic. Additionally, there could be a problem with the window regulator, which is responsible for moving the window up and down. If the regulator is faulty, it will need to be repaired or replaced.
